About This Location

Deer Creek State Park is a productive birding destination in Ohio, with 224 species recorded on eBird. This river/riparian habitat attracts Canada Goose, Tundra Swan, and American Wigeon among many others. Spring migration along the Mississippi and Central Flyways makes this a vital stopover for diverse species.

Birding Tips

  1. 1

    Walk along the water slowly, scanning overhanging branches for kingfishers and warblers.

  2. 2

    Check sandbars and gravel bars for shorebirds and terns.

  3. 3

    Time your visit during the first week of May for maximum species diversity.
